Primark Recalls Children's Bamboo Plates Due to Risk of Lead and Chemical Exposure Hazards

Official recall recorded by the U.S. Consumer Product Safety Commission.

The hazard

The recalled children's bamboo plates have elevated levels of lead and formaldehyde. Both lead and formaldehyde are toxic if ingested by children and can cause adverse health effects.

What to do

Consumers should immediately take the recalled plates away from children, stop using them and return them to a Primark store for a full refund or consumers can contact Primark for instructions on how to properly dispose of the product to also receive a full refund.
